Optimizing Plastic Pelletizing Machine Performance
To ensure optimal plastic pellet production machine operation, several key factors should be carefully evaluated. Preventative maintenance of the system and sizing head is paramount for stable product quality . In addition , optimizing the auger speed and temperature within the extruder can noticeably boost production rate and lessen rejects. Finally, proper polymer conditioning is imperative to avoid problems like dampness -induced granule fractures and weakened mechanical strength .

Beverage Bottle Recycling: From Trash to Valuable Granules
The system of PET bottle recycling has undergone a significant transformation , moving beyond simple repurposing . Discarded beverage bottles are now efficiently gathered and sorted, then shredded into small chips . These materials undergo a detailed cleaning sequence to remove residue, followed by fusing and extrusion into uniform, high-quality pellets . This generates a valuable resource – post-consumer recycled (PCR) PET – that can be employed to manufacture a broad range of new products , lowering reliance on virgin plastics .

Comprehensive Plastic Processing: Sanitizing, Chopping, and Extruding
The advanced integrated plastic recovery process typically involves several crucial stages. Initially, plastics undergo a complete washing routine to eliminate contaminants like residues and dirt . Following this, the rinsed plastic is then fed into a chopper which reduces it to manageable pieces. Finally, these ground fragments are transformed and converted into uniform pellets, prepared for reuse in new plastic products .
